I meant 3b2787e fixed it. I checked that at least the situation doesn't happen after 3b2787e. > How did you recreate the problem? Do you have a test case you can share? I recreated it by executing each steps step by step using gdb. So I can share the test case but it might not help. create extension pageinspect; create table g (c int[]); insert into g select ARRAY[1] from generate_series(1,1000); create index g_idx on g using gin (c); alter table g set (autovacuum_enabled = off); insert into g select ARRAY[1] from generate_series(1, 408); -- 408 items fit in exactly one page of pending list insert into g select ARRAY[1] from generate_series(1, 100); -- insert into 2nd page of pending list select n_pending_pages, n_pending_tuples from gin_metapage_info(get_raw_page('g_idx', 0)); insert into g select ARRAY[999]; -- insert into 2nd pending list page delete from g where c = ARRAY[999]; -- At this point, gin entry of 'ARRAY[999]' exists on 2nd page of pending list and deleted.
